Taming Stress with HRV Biofeedback: Regulating Heart Rhythm for Calm and Resilience

In today's fast-paced world, stress has become an unavoidable part of life. Chronic stress can negatively impact our physical, emotional, and mental well-being. Luckily, a powerful tool exists to help us manage stress and cultivate inner peace: HRV biofeedback.

HRV stands for heart rate variability, which refers to the minute fluctuations in the time between each heartbeat. A high HRV indicates good health and resilience, while low HRV is often associated with stress and fatigue. HRV biofeedback utilizes this information to provide real-time feedback on your heart rhythm.

By learning to influence these subtle changes, you can actively regulate your heart rate and promote a state of calmness. This technique empowers individuals to mitigate stress, boost focus, and nurture overall well-being.

Through consistent practice and awareness, HRV biofeedback can become a valuable tool in your repertoire for managing stress and achieving greater balance.

EEG Neurofeedback: Retraining Your Brainwaves for Optimal Function and Performance

Neurofeedback, also known as EEG biofeedback, is a remarkable technique that empowers individuals to gain influence over their brainwave activity. By providing real-time feedback on brainwave patterns through visual or auditory signals, neurofeedback retrains the brain to operate at a more efficient state. This process can lead to tangible improvements in various areas, such as attention, focus, stress management, and emotional regulation.

During a neurofeedback session, sensors are placed on the scalp to monitor brainwave activity. The obtained data is then analyzed by a computer and transformed into auditory feedback. As individuals learn to modify their brainwaves according to the feedback, they enhance neural pathways associated with beneficial states.

  • Through regular neurofeedback sessions, individuals can alleviate symptoms of anxiety, depression, and ADHD.
  • Neurofeedback can also improve cognitive function, including memory, attention, and processing speed.
  • Moreover, it can induce relaxation and stress reduction, leading to a greater sense of well-being.
